The Finnish people love to drink.

Sadly, they love it so much that, soon after the alcohol tax drop of 2004, drinking became the number one cause of death in the Nordic nation.

Things have turned around somewhat since, with alcohol consumption levels declining steadily every year.

To ensure that trend continues, Fragile Childhood, a Finnish nonprofit, has launched an awareness campaign aimed at curbing alcohol abuse. It works by terrifying the ever-loving desire to drink out of prospective imbibers.
